Pokemon GOFest 2023 is set to occur in multiple cities worldwide, with two gameplay areas available in each location. The event locations are London, England; Osaka, Japan; and New York City (NYC), USA. The London and Osaka GO Fest will be active from August 4 to 6, while the NYC event will run from August 18 to 20. Additionally, players can partake in a two-day GO Fest 2023 Global event on August 26 and 27, 2023. The event offers two Timed Research Storylines, one of which is the Shimmering Strides Timed Research.

ThePokemon GOFest 2023ticket holders can access two Timed Research storylines. The first Timed Research, centered around Carbink, is no longer obtainable since the tickets are no longer available. However, the second Timed Research, Shimmering Strides, is currently accessible to ticket purchasersbefore August 02, 2025.
The Shimmering Strides Timed Research has just 1 Step with multiple tasks. Completing these tasks before August 26, 10am local time, rewards players withmultiple in-game items. The Timed Research ranges from a simple task of exploring the neighborhood to completing several otherPokemon GOField Research tasks. While it might not take much effort for players to complete the Shimmering Strides Timed Research, it is one of the most celebrated due to the reward of Carbink Shoes.
Explore 1km
Spin 10 PokeStops or Gyms
Complete 5 Field research tasks
Earn 3 Candies walking with your Buddy

Apart from the Timed Research tasks,Pokemon GOFest 2023 offers the debut ofMega Rayquaza in raids. Also, special Pocket Monsters will appear in four unique habitats; Quartz Terrarium, Pyrite Sands, Malachite Wilderness, and Aquamarine Shores. Multiple Pokemon and Shiny variants feature in each habitat, and the habitats will rotate hourly during the global event.
